Section: Why choose OpenVPN on EdgeRouter
OpenVPN is known for strong security, cross-platform compatibility, and good performance on low-power devices. Running OpenVPN on EdgeRouter gives you:
- Centralized remote access to home or office resources
- Full control over encryption settings and authentication methods
- Compatibility with a wide range of clients Windows, macOS, Linux, iOS, Android
- No dependency on third-party VPN services for tunneling
- The ability to split-tunnel or force all traffic through the VPN
EdgeRouter models can handle OpenVPN well when configured properly. The setup is more involved than consumer-grade VPN apps, but the payoff is a robust, customizable solution that you own completely.

Section: Firewall, NAT, and port considerations
- Port considerations: If your ISP blocks UDP 1194, you can switch to TCP 443 though OpenVPN over TCP can be slower. Some admins hide OpenVPN traffic behind TLS on port 443 for better traversal.
- NAT vs bridged mode: OpenVPN often uses NAT masquerading to allow VPN clients to reach the internet. If you need devices on the VPN to appear on the LAN directly, you may explore bridged configurations, but NAT is simpler and more common for home setups.
- Firewall zoning: Put the VPN interface in a separate zone and restrict inbound traffic to only what’s needed for your use cases.

Section: Practical configuration example simplified

CA, server, and client keys and certificates:
- CA key: ca.key
- CA certificate: ca.crt
- Server key: server.key
- Server certificate: server.crt
- Client key: client1.key
- Client certificate: client1.crt
-
Server config server.conf:
port 1194
proto udp
dev tun
ca ca.crt
cert server.crt
key server.key
dh dh.pem
server 10.8.0.0 255.255.255.0
ifconfig-pool 10.8.0.2 10.8.0.254
push “redirect-gateway def1”
push “dhcp-option DNS 8.8.8.8”
keepalive 10 120
cipher AES-256-CBC
auth SHA256
user nobody
group nogroup
persist-key
persist-tun
status openvpn-status.log
verb 3 -
Client config client1.ovpn:
client
dev tun
proto udp
remote your_ddns_or_ip 1194
resolv-retry infinite
nobind
persist-key
persist-tun
remote-cert-tls server
ca ca.crt
cert client1.crt
key client1.key
cipher AES-256-CBC
auth SHA256
verb 3
Section: Common issues and fixes
- OpenVPN service won’t start: Check logs for TLS/certificate errors or port conflicts.
- VPN connects but no internet: Verify redirect-gateway and DNS settings; ensure NAT is set correctly.
- DNS leaks: Ensure the VPN pushes a DNS server and the client config doesn’t override with local DNS.
- Slow speeds: UDP generally performs better; consider tuning MTU, compression settings, or hardware limitations of EdgeRouter.

Section: Comparison with other VPN options on EdgeRouter
- OpenVPN vs IPsec: OpenVPN tends to be simpler to configure for remote access and offers more flexible client support; IPsec can be faster in some scenarios but may require more complex key management.
- WireGuard: If you’re open to newer tech, WireGuard on EdgeRouter offers high performance and simplicity, but may require more manual setup and compatibility checks with clients.
- Commercial VPN services: They’re easier for quick setup but give up some control and may come with ongoing costs.

How long does it take to set up an OpenVPN server on EdgeRouter?
Setting up an OpenVPN server on EdgeRouter typically takes 1–2 hours for a first-timer, including certificate creation, server configuration, and client provisioning. If you’re already comfortable with EdgeOS, you can complete it in under an hour.
Do I need a static IP to run OpenVPN on EdgeRouter?
Not strictly. You can use a dynamic DNS DDNS service to reach your EdgeRouter from outside your network. A stable DDNS hostname makes remote access much easier.
Is OpenVPN on EdgeRouter secure by default?
OpenVPN is secure when configured with proper certificates, TLS authentication, and up-to-date firmware. Avoid default passwords, enable firewall rules, and rotate certificates regularly for stronger security.
Can I run OpenVPN alongside other VPN protocols on EdgeRouter?
Yes, you can run OpenVPN while also keeping other services like SSH or a separate VPN protocol. Just ensure firewall rules don’t conflict and that you don’t open more ports than needed.
What are the common issues when connecting clients?
Common issues include certificate mismatches, server address misconfigurations, port blocking by ISP, and DNS leaks. Double-check the .ovpn profiles, server settings, and firewall rules if connections fail. How do I test if VPN traffic is routing through the tunnel?
Check your public IP from a client connected to the VPN; it should reflect the VPN exit IP. Also, try pinging a known LAN device or accessing a private resource behind the VPN.
Can I use OpenVPN with mobile devices?
Absolutely. OpenVPN supports Windows, macOS, iOS, and Android. Use OpenVPN Connect apps on mobile devices and import your .ovpn profiles.
What performance considerations should I expect?
Performance depends on your EdgeRouter model, CPU, and network load. UDP generally performs better than TCP for OpenVPN. You may need to tweak MTU, compression, and route settings for optimal results.
How do I rotate OpenVPN certificates?
Create a new CA or new server/client certificates and revoke the old ones. Update the server configuration and reissue client profiles accordingly. Revoke roles and accounts if needed.
